Are you a book lover? Well, there is nothing like a local Georgetown bookstore that is run by volunteers. They have thoughtfully curated a collection of donated books, and are super excited to help you find what you are looking for. The best part is… the proceeds go towards scholarships for students! This gorgeous two story bookstore with history connecting it to Bryn Mawr is unique and charming. Stop by for a peek — the prices are good. More enticingly, if you have any extra bags (paper or otherwise), or some books you don’t mind parting with because they remain untouched donate them! The volunteer staff are so kind and happy to help.
